To solve the equation \( 4x = 3(x + 5) - 15 \), let's simplify both sides step by step.

1. Start with the original equation:
\[
4x = 3(x + 5) - 15
\]

2. Distribute on the right side:
\[
4x = 3x + 15 - 15
\]
Simplifying the right side gives:
\[
4x = 3x + 0
\]
Which simplifies to:
\[
4x = 3x
\]

3. Subtract \( 3x \) from both sides:
\[
4x - 3x = 0
\]
This simplifies to:
\[
x = 0
\]

Now let's analyze the solutions:
- The equation has one unique solution: \( x = 0 \).

Thus, the correct response is:
**The equation has one solution: \( x = 0 \).**
